This Tuscaloosa Regional Airport → Alexandria International Airport route is 509 km (316 mi) end to end. The estimated flight time is 01h 23m, and a passenger's share of CO₂ works out at roughly 45 kg.

Tuscaloosa Regional Airport to Alexandria International Airport FAQ
How far is Tuscaloosa Regional Airport from Alexandria International Airport?
Tuscaloosa Regional Airport (TCL) and Alexandria International Airport (AEX) are 509 km (316 mi) apart, measured along the great-circle route.
How long is the flight from Tuscaloosa Regional Airport to Alexandria International Airport?
A direct TCL–AEX flight covers the distance in about 01h 23m, though the exact time shifts with aircraft type and winds.
How much CO₂ does a flight from Tuscaloosa Regional Airport to Alexandria International Airport produce?
A passenger's share of CO₂ on the TCL–AEX route is roughly 45 kg.
Which airlines fly from Tuscaloosa Regional Airport to Alexandria International Airport?
Air Wisconsin operate scheduled service between TCL and AEX.
